Shrub care involves the regular maintenance, pruning, and health management of ornamental and structural shrubs in the landscape. Proper care ensures that shrubs keep their intended size, shape, and density while promoting healthy development and blooming. Pruning gets rid of dead or diseased wood, enhances air circulation, and motivates brand-new shoots, which is vital for long-term vigor. Seasonal considerations are important-- pruning at the incorrect time can reduce flowering or stress the plant. Fertilization, mulching, and bug monitoring are likewise important elements of shrub care, helping plants withstand disease and ecological stressors. Healthy shrubs supply structure, personal privacy, and year-round interest in the landscape. Constant care keeps them looking their finest and ensures they contribute positively to the overall aesthetic of the property
